IND vs SL 2022: Shikhar Dhawan dropped from ODI squad, Shivam Mavi and Mukesh Kumar earn maiden T20I call-up

India’s veteran opener Shikhar Dhawan has been dropped from the three-match ODI squad against Sri Lanka, the BCCI confirmed on Tuesday. The left-hander has been under the scanner recently, averaging 34.40 with a strike rate of 74.21 in 2022.

Furthermore, the good performances of Shubman Gill and Ishan Kishan in the 50-overs format have also put pressure on him. Thus, this call from the board casts a shadow of doubt on Dhawan’s future and his participation in the 2023 World Cup.

Gill had an average of over 70 with a strike rate of 102.57 in 2022 whereas Ishan Kishan hogged the limelight after scoring a fine double-century in the third ODI against Bangladesh.

Meanwhile, Shivam Mavi and Mukesh Kumar have earned their maiden T20I call-up for the three-match series. Hardik Pandya will lead the team in the T20I series whereas Rohit Sharma will return to captain for the ODI series.

Moreover, Pandya has been appointed as the vice-captain for the T20Is and ODIs, replacing KL Rahul, who will miss the T20I series. Suryakumar Yadav will be Pandya’s deputy in the T20I series.

On the other hand, Rohit Sharma, and Virat Kohli will miss the T20I series against the Island country whereas Ravindra Jadeja and Jasprit Bumrah continue to recover from their respective injuries.

Ruturaj Gaikwad and Rahul Tripathi have been added to the T20I squad after their impressive show in the domestic circuit.

The T20I series begins on January 3 in Mumbai. The ODIs will be played on January 10, 12, and 15.

T20I squad: Hardik Pandya (C), Ishan Kishan (wk), Ruturaj Gaikwad, Shubman Gill, Suryakumar Yadav (VC), Deepak Hooda, Rahul Tripathi, Sanju Samson, Washington Sundar, Yuzvendra Chahal, Axar Patel, Arshdeep Singh, Harshal Patel, Umran Malik, Shivam Mavi, Mukesh Kumar.

ODI squad: Rohit Sharma (C), Shubman Gill, Virat Kohli, Suryakumar Yadav, Shreyas Iyer, KL Rahul (wk), Ishan Kishan (wk), Hardik Pandya (VC), Washington Sundar, Yuzvendra Chahal, Kuldeep Yadav, Axar Patel, Mohd. Shami, Mohd. Siraj, Umran Malik, Arshdeep Singh.
